FEIYU TRANS (Sole-Proprietor) is an organisation established on 04 Apr 2016 and its current status is
Live
. The organisation is located at 135 LORONG AH SOO #05-500, Singapore 530135. The organisation operates in the field of street-hail and ride-hail service providers.
